Meet the Hikvision L2 Smart Managed 24-Port Gigabit PoE Switch, a compact yet powerful networking solution designed to simplify powering and managing your PoE devices. With 24 PoE ports, 2 Gigabit SFP uplinks, and a total PoE budget of up to 370W, it is an ideal choice for surveillance deployments, wireless access points, VoIP phones, and other PoE-enabled devices in small to mid-size environments.
Powered by industry-leading Hikvision engineering, this L2 Smart Managed switch delivers centralized control, reliable performance, and scalable growth for growing networks. Its streamlined management capabilities help you monitor device status, configure settings, and ensure your IP devices stay connected with minimal effort.

Technical Specifications
- PoE Ports: 24 x 10/100/1000 Mbps PoE (802.3af/at)
- Uplink Ports: 2 x Gigabit SFP
- PoE Budget: Up to 370W (max)
- Management: L2 Smart Managed switch with centralized configuration and monitoring
- Standards Supported: IEEE 802.3af/at (PoE/PoE+)
